Abstract :
Resistivity ρ(T), magnetoresistivity Δρ/ρ, and magnetic susceptibility χ(T) measurements on a single crystal of the non-magnetically ordered Kondo semimetal U2Ru2Sn are presented. The resistivity is highly anisotropic and yields band-gap values according to an activation-like description that differ by two orders of magnitude depending on the current direction. The temperature dependence of magnetoresistivity for both perpendicular arrangements (j∥c,B∥a, or j∥a,B∥c) renders the same behavior (Δρ/ρ positive with a peak near 25 K). In the longitudinal arrangement, j∥c∥B, the magnetoresistivity is much smaller and changes sign at the temperature of a knee in ρ(T) at 30 K.
